.hero-neutral-stage[data-astro-cid-bbe6dxrz]{background:radial-gradient(circle,#0e7c7b0d 0%,#fff0 60%)}.hero-rings[data-astro-cid-bbe6dxrz]{z-index:0}.hero-rings[data-astro-cid-bbe6dxrz] .ring[data-astro-cid-bbe6dxrz]{opacity:0;will-change:transform,opacity;border:1.5px solid #0e7c7b59;border-radius:50%;width:80px;height:80px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)scale(.6)}.hero-rings[data-astro-cid-bbe6dxrz].hero-rings-lg .ring[data-astro-cid-bbe6dxrz]{width:120px;height:120px}.hero-rings[data-astro-cid-bbe6dxrz] .ring-1[data-astro-cid-bbe6dxrz]{animation:4.8s cubic-bezier(.4,0,.2,1) infinite ringPulse}.hero-rings[data-astro-cid-bbe6dxrz] .ring-2[data-astro-cid-bbe6dxrz]{animation:4.8s cubic-bezier(.4,0,.2,1) -1.2s infinite ringPulse}.hero-rings[data-astro-cid-bbe6dxrz] .ring-3[data-astro-cid-bbe6dxrz]{animation:4.8s cubic-bezier(.4,0,.2,1) -2.4s infinite ringPulse}.hero-rings[data-astro-cid-bbe6dxrz] .ring-4[data-astro-cid-bbe6dxrz]{animation:4.8s cubic-bezier(.4,0,.2,1) -3.6s infinite ringPulse}@keyframes ringPulse{0%{opacity:0;border-color:#0e7c7b8c;transform:translate(-50%,-50%)scale(.55)}15%{opacity:.55}to{opacity:0;border-color:#0e7c7b0d;transform:translate(-50%,-50%)scale(3.4)}}.ring-halo[data-astro-cid-bbe6dxrz]{filter:blur(8px);will-change:transform,opacity;background:radial-gradient(circle,#ffffffd9 0%,#fff6 35%,#0e7c7b0a 65%,#0000 80%);border-radius:50%;width:240px;height:240px;animation:6s ease-in-out infinite haloBreath;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.ring-halo-lg[data-astro-cid-bbe6dxrz]{filter:blur(14px);width:340px;height:340px}@keyframes haloBreath{0%,to{opacity:.85;transform:translate(-50%,-50%)scale(1)}50%{opacity:1;transform:translate(-50%,-50%)scale(1.06)}}.hero-soft-float[data-astro-cid-bbe6dxrz]{filter:drop-shadow(0 14px 28px #0e7c7b38);will-change:transform;animation:5s ease-in-out infinite heroSoftFloat}@keyframes heroSoftFloat{0%,to{transform:translateY(0)}50%{transform:translateY(-8px)}}.hero-check-pill[data-astro-cid-bbe6dxrz]{background:linear-gradient(135deg,#07ca6b,#059669);border-radius:999px;justify-content:center;align-items:center;width:22px;height:22px;margin-top:2px;display:inline-flex;box-shadow:0 2px 6px #07ca6b59}.hero-check-pill[data-astro-cid-bbe6dxrz] i[data-astro-cid-bbe6dxrz],.hero-check-pill[data-astro-cid-bbe6dxrz] svg[data-astro-cid-bbe6dxrz]{stroke-width:3px;flex-shrink:0;width:14px!important;height:14px!important}.hero-trust-card[data-astro-cid-bbe6dxrz]{text-align:center;background:linear-gradient(#e8f7f6d9,#ffffffb3);border:1px solid #0e7c7b24;border-radius:14px;padding:12px 14px;position:relative;box-shadow:0 4px 12px #0e7c7b0d}.hero-trust-card[data-astro-cid-bbe6dxrz] .flex[data-astro-cid-bbe6dxrz].items-center.gap-2,.hero-trust-card[data-astro-cid-bbe6dxrz] .flex[data-astro-cid-bbe6dxrz].items-center.gap-2\.5{justify-content:center}.hero-trust-pulse[data-astro-cid-bbe6dxrz]{background:#10b981;border-radius:50%;flex-shrink:0;width:8px;height:8px;animation:2s cubic-bezier(0,0,.2,1) infinite heroTrustPing;position:relative;box-shadow:0 0 #10b981b3}@keyframes heroTrustPing{0%{box-shadow:0 0 #10b98199}70%{box-shadow:0 0 0 8px #10b98100}to{box-shadow:0 0 #10b98100}}.hero-trust-stat[data-astro-cid-bbe6dxrz]{text-align:center;background:#ffffffb3;border:1px solid #0e7c7b14;border-radius:10px;flex-direction:column;justify-content:center;align-items:center;min-height:64px;padding:10px 6px;display:flex}.hero-trust-num[data-astro-cid-bbe6dxrz]{color:#0e7c7b;letter-spacing:-.5px;text-align:center;font-size:18px;font-weight:800;line-height:1}.hero-trust-lbl[data-astro-cid-bbe6dxrz]{color:#6b7280;text-align:center;margin-top:6px;font-size:10px;line-height:1.3}@media (width>=1024px){.hero-trust-num[data-astro-cid-bbe6dxrz]{font-size:22px}.hero-trust-lbl[data-astro-cid-bbe6dxrz]{font-size:11px}.hero-trust-stat[data-astro-cid-bbe6dxrz]{padding:10px 6px}}@media (prefers-reduced-motion:reduce){.hero-rings[data-astro-cid-bbe6dxrz] .ring[data-astro-cid-bbe6dxrz],.ring-halo[data-astro-cid-bbe6dxrz],.hero-soft-float[data-astro-cid-bbe6dxrz],.hero-trust-pulse[data-astro-cid-bbe6dxrz]{animation:none!important}.hero-rings[data-astro-cid-bbe6dxrz] .ring[data-astro-cid-bbe6dxrz]{opacity:0}.ring-halo[data-astro-cid-bbe6dxrz]{opacity:.85}}.helpful-btn[data-astro-cid-aadlzisc].voted{color:#fff;background:linear-gradient(135deg,#07ca6b,#10b981);border-color:#10b981;box-shadow:0 4px 12px #10b98140}.helpful-btn[data-astro-cid-aadlzisc].voted:hover{color:#fff;background:linear-gradient(135deg,#06b362,#0ea66f)}.ff-input[data-astro-cid-sdfchni5],.ff-input-wrap[data-astro-cid-sdfchni5]{transition:border-color .15s,box-shadow .15s}.ff-input[data-astro-cid-sdfchni5]:hover,.ff-input-wrap[data-astro-cid-sdfchni5]:hover{border-color:#9ca3af}.ff-input[data-astro-cid-sdfchni5]:focus,.ff-input-wrap[data-astro-cid-sdfchni5]:focus-within{border-color:#0e7c7b;box-shadow:0 0 0 3px #1e3a8a33}.floating-cta[data-astro-cid-j7pv25f6]{z-index:40;animation:.5s ease-out float-up;position:fixed;bottom:20px;left:50%;transform:translate(-50%)}@keyframes float-up{0%{opacity:0;transform:translate(-50%)translateY(20px)}to{opacity:1;transform:translate(-50%)translateY(0)}}
